When it comes to reviewing Wegman's... well words cannot really describe the enormity of the place. I don't think I need to explain what a supermarket is, so let me get to the point. This place is big, really big, and they have a lot of stuff. By stuff I mean food, drinks, flowers, herbs, home products, etc, all the stuff. Their selection is really mind boggling, especially in their unique sections like international. Normally to buy a tomatillo, Goya coconut milk, serano chili, and fabric softener you'd have to drive all over the place. Wegman's has it all in one place so you don't have to search around.

They also have their own brand which is actually pretty good. I normally don't trust generic products but theirs are good, and have clear labeling that I wish the brand name stuff would use.

And then there's the food court area. They have a fairly massive section with things like a deli, sushi, Asian buffet, pizza, cheeses, seafood, and gourmet salads all in a big L shaped ring. There are usually all sorts of free samples for you to try, and when you decide on something, you can go up on the mezzanine and watch the ensuing chaos below while you eat.

Wegman's has a great model that's sure to please every shoppers' needs. Check it out!

I am so glad to have happened upon the Wegmans Food Market in Hunt Valley back in 2006.  I am even more glad that one is coming to Columbia.  Shopping there has its perks.  The first time I went, they gave us one big bottle of apple juice from their brand.  Not knowing it was some promotion (they don't always give you a free bottle of juice), I went back.  Kind of naive in retrospect.  Even though I didn't get another bottle of juice, I got hooked on the store.

Wegmans really isn't just any grocery store. The Hunt Valley Wegmans is huge--probably 3 times the size of my neighborhood Safeway (and the Safeway isn't small) and its offerings reminds me of a Wholefoods, Safeway, and a mini food court combined.  If it's a food product you are looking for, Wegmans probably has it (where else can you buy hazelnut milk?) along with people who will do their best to lead you to it (which comes in handy since you could get lost in there); or if it's something from one of their particular stations (produce, ethnic, cheese, etc.), there will be an expert around to tell you about it.  Even if you don't enjoy grocery shopping, you could go to Wegmans and get all of your grocery shopping done in one convenient location.  Did I mention, it's decorated?  Toy trains chug along overhead (you'll see what I mean when you go there), which can probably grab the attention of any little ones you might bring along for at least a minute or so...

According to Matthew Boyle of Fortune Magazine, "each Wegmans store boasts a prodigious, pulchritudinous produce section, bountiful baked goods fresh from the oven, and a deftly displayed collection of some 500 cheeses. You'll also find a bookstore, child play centers, a dry cleaner, video rentals, a photo lab, international newspapers, a florist, a wine shop, a pharmacy, even an $850 espresso maker."  I think what is most fascinating to me is their 500 cheeses.  Another nice thing about Wegmans is that they'll cut most of their cheeses into even smaller pieces if you ask them (although I don't think they will cut the pre-packaged mini disks but you probably want all of that to yourself anyways), or you could ask for a sample (you can sample their bread too).

Their bakery totally rocks!  They have a Rosemary Sea Salt loaf that I can happily munch on as a meal in itself.  Yum yum!

Usually I'm sketched out by Chinese buffets and although I wouldn't go all the way to Wegmans just to eat their Chinese food, even their Chinese isn't bad.

I'll agree that it costs more, but even if you don't decide to buy anything... it's definitely something to look at.
